Modifier and Type | Method and Description |
---|---|
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ator marks the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.LeafNodeBuilderDefinedContext.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ator marks the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.LeafNodeBuilderCustomizableContext.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ator mark the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.LeafNodeContextBuilder.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ator mark the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.NodeBuilderDefinedContext.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ator marks the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.NodeBuilderCustomizableContext.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ator mark the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.NodeContextBuilder.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ator mark the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.ContainerElementNodeBuilderDefinedContext.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ator marks the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.ContainerElementNodeBuilderCustomizableContext.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ator mark the value as invalid. |
ConstraintValidatorContext |
ConstraintValidatorContext.ConstraintViolationBuilder.ContainerElementNodeContextBuilder.addConstraintViolation()
Adds the new
ConstraintViolation to be generated if the
constraint validator mark the value as invalid. |
Modifier and Type | Method and Description |
---|---|
boolean |
ConstraintValidator.isValid(T value,
ConstraintValidatorContext context)
Implements the validation logic.
|
Modifier and Type | Interface and Description |
---|---|
interface |
HibernateConstraintValidatorContext
A custom
ConstraintValidatorContext which allows to set additional message parameters for
interpolation. |
Modifier and Type | Method and Description |
---|---|
boolean |
RegexpURLValidator.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
Modifier and Type | Method and Description |
---|---|
boolean |
AbstractEmailValidator.isValid(CharSequence value,
ConstraintValidatorContext context) |
Modifier and Type | Method and Description |
---|---|
boolean |
AssertTrueValidator.isValid(Boolean bool,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
AssertFalseValidator.isValid(Boolean bool,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
NotBlankValidator.isValid(CharSequence charSequence,
ConstraintValidatorContext constraintValidatorContext)
Checks that the character sequence is not
null nor empty after removing any leading or trailing
whitespace. |
boolean |
EmailValidator.isValid(CharSequence value,
ConstraintValidatorContext context) |
boolean |
PatternValidator.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
MinValidatorForCharSequence.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
MaxValidatorForCharSequence.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
DigitsValidatorForCharSequence.isValid(CharSequence charSequence,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
DecimalMinValidatorForCharSequence.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
DecimalMaxValidatorForCharSequence.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
DigitsValidatorForNumber.isValid(Number num,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
NullValidator.isValid(Object object,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
NotNullValidator.isValid(Object object,
ConstraintValidatorContext constraintValidatorContext) |
Modifier and Type | Method and Description |
---|---|
boolean |
PositiveVal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
MinVal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
MaxVal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
DecimalMinVal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
DecimalMaxVal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
boolean |
CurrencyValidatorForMonetaryAmount.isValid(MonetaryAmount value,
ConstraintValidatorContext context) |
Modifier and Type | Method and Description |
---|---|
boolean |
NotEmptyValidatorForArraysOfBoolean.isValid(boolean[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ForArraysOfByte.isValid(byte[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ForArraysOfChar.isValid(char[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ForCharSequence.isValid(CharSequence charSequence,
ConstraintValidatorContext constraintValidatorContext)
Checks the character sequence is not
null and not empty. |
boolean |
NotEmptyValidatorForCollection.isValid(Collection collection,
ConstraintValidatorContext constraintValidatorContext)
Checks the collection is not
null and not empty. |
boolean |
NotEmptyValidatorForArraysOfDouble.isValid(double[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ForArraysOfFloat.isValid(float[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ForArraysOfInt.isValid(int[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ForArraysOfLong.isValid(long[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ForMap.isValid(Map map,
ConstraintValidatorContext constraintValidatorContext)
Checks the map is not
null and not empty. |
boolean |
NotEmptyValidatorForArray.isValid(Object[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
boolean |
NotEmptyValidatorForArraysOfShort.isValid(short[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the array is not
null and not empty. |
Modifier and Type | Method and Description |
---|---|
boolean |
AbstractMinValidator.isValid(T value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
AbstractMaxValidator.isValid(T value,
ConstraintValidatorContext constraintValidatorContext) |
Modifier and Type | Method and Description |
---|---|
boolean |
AbstractDecimalMinValidator.isValid(T value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
AbstractDecimalMaxValidator.isValid(T value,
ConstraintValidatorContext constraintValidatorContext) |
Modifier and Type | Method and Description |
---|---|
boolean |
PositiveValidatorForBigDecimal.isValid(BigDecimal value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ForBigDecimal.isValid(BigDecimal value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ForBigDecimal.isValid(BigDecimal value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ForBigDecimal.isValid(BigDecimal value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ForBigInteger.isValid(BigInteger value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ForBigInteger.isValid(BigInteger value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ForBigInteger.isValid(BigInteger value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ForBigInteger.isValid(BigInteger value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ForByte.isValid(Byte value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ForByte.isValid(Byte value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ForByte.isValid(Byte value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ForByte.isValid(Byte value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ForDouble.isValid(Double value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ForDouble.isValid(Double value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ForDouble.isValid(Double value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ForDouble.isValid(Double value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ForFloat.isValid(Float value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ForFloat.isValid(Float value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ForFloat.isValid(Float value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ForFloat.isValid(Float value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ForInteger.isValid(Integer value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ForInteger.isValid(Integer value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ForInteger.isValid(Integer value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ForInteger.isValid(Integer value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ForLong.isValid(Long value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ForLong.isValid(Long value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ForLong.isValid(Long value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ForLong.isValid(Long value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ForNumber.isValid(Number value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ForNumber.isValid(Number value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ForNumber.isValid(Number value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ForNumber.isValid(Number value,
ConstraintValidatorContext context) |
boolean |
PositiveValidatorForShort.isValid(Short value,
ConstraintValidatorContext context) |
boolean |
PositiveOrZeroValidatorForShort.isValid(Short value,
ConstraintValidatorContext context) |
boolean |
NegativeValidatorForShort.isValid(Short value,
ConstraintValidatorContext context) |
boolean |
NegativeOrZeroValidatorForShort.isValid(Short value,
ConstraintValidatorContext context) |
Modifier and Type | Method and Description |
---|---|
boolean |
SizeValidatorForArraysOfBoolean.isValid(boolean[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ForArraysOfByte.isValid(byte[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ForArraysOfChar.isValid(char[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ForCharSequence.isValid(CharSequence charSequence,
ConstraintValidatorContext constraintValidatorContext)
Checks the length of the specified character sequence (e.g.
|
boolean |
SizeValidatorForCollection.isValid(Collection collection,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in a collection.
|
boolean |
SizeValidatorForArraysOfDouble.isValid(double[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ForArraysOfFloat.isValid(float[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ForArraysOfInt.isValid(int[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ForArraysOfLong.isValid(long[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ForMap.isValid(Map map,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in a map.
|
boolean |
SizeValidatorForArray.isValid(Object[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
boolean |
SizeValidatorForArraysOfShort.isValid(short[] array,
ConstraintValidatorContext constraintValidatorContext)
Checks the number of entries in an array.
|
Modifier and Type | Method and Description |
---|---|
boolean |
AbstractJavaTimeValidator.isValid(T value,
ConstraintValidatorContext context) |
boolean |
AbstractInstantBasedTimeValidator.isValid(T value,
ConstraintValidatorContext context) |
boolean |
AbstractEpochBasedTimeValidator.isValid(T value,
ConstraintValidatorContext context) |
Modifier and Type | Method and Description |
---|---|
boolean |
ISBNValidator.isValid(CharSequence isbn,
ConstraintValidatorContext context) |
boolean |
CodePointLengthValidator.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
URLValidator.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
SafeHtmlValidator.isValid(CharSequence value,
ConstraintValidatorContext context) |
boolean |
NotBlankValidator.isValid(CharSequence charSequence,
ConstraintValidatorContext constraintValidatorContext)
Checks that the trimmed string is not empty.
|
boolean |
ModCheckBase.isValid(CharSequence value,
ConstraintValidatorContext context) |
boolean |
LengthValidator.isValid(CharSequence value,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
EANValidator.isValid(CharSequence value,
ConstraintValidatorContext context) |
boolean |
UniqueElementsValidator.isValid(Collection collection,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
ParameterScriptAssertValidator.isValid(Object[] arguments,
ConstraintValidatorContext constraintValidatorContext) |
boolean |
ScriptAssertValidator.isValid(Object value,
ConstraintValidatorContext constraintValidatorContext) |
Modifier and Type | Method and Description |
---|---|
boolean |
CPFValidator.isValid(CharSequence value,
ConstraintValidatorContext context) |
boolean |
CNPJValidator.isValid(CharSequence value,
ConstraintValidatorContext context) |
Modifier and Type | Method and Description |
---|---|
boolean |
DurationMinValidator.isValid(Duration value,
ConstraintValidatorContext context) |
boolean |
DurationMaxValidator.isValid(Duration value,
ConstraintValidatorContext context) |
Modifier and Type | Class and Description |
---|---|
class |
ConstraintValidatorContextImpl |
Copyright © 2019 JBoss by Red Hat. All rights reserved.